The 61-year-old television host underwent a gastric bypass procedure in 1999 after spending years battling with her weight, but she admits she felt like a "cheat" because she wasnt losing the pounds healthily.
Speaking to Entertainment Tonight, she said: "I felt like such a cheat when I had that band on my stomach. It makes you vomit the whole time. Nothing goes down because it goes out."
The former X Factor UK judge - who is married to Ozzy Osbourne and has children Aimee, Kelly and Jack - now controls her weight by sticking to the low-carbohydrate Atkins diet, but she admits she still has "cheat" days.
She explained: "Id be fibbing if I said I dont cheat because I do cheat. I cheat a lot on my diet. We all do, but I dont guilt myself
out because the next day Ill start with my Atkins breakfast sandwich and Im right back on it."
